Early impression of a 2016 Q5 TDI
Q5 TDI driver, Norwood, MA, 11/26/2015
2016 Audi Q5 TDI Premium Plus quattro 4dr SUV AWD (3.0L 6cyl Turbodiesel 8A)
I've become a big fan of diesels for their driving characteristics and efficiency. The Q5 TDI does not disappoint. This SUV is very quick with little turbo lag, which gives a lot of confidence pulling out into traffic and merging, whether from a stop or at highway speeds. The engine is very refined. For a family of 4 I felt the Q5 was the right size. I also liked the 3L TDI over the … 2L offerings in BMW and MB. There is not much of a hit in mugs going with the 3L, since I have been getting around 30 mpg around town and mid 30s on the highway. The seats are comfortable, although they could be softer. The lumbar support is good. The sound quality of the Bang and Olufsen sound system is very good. The MMI infotainment system takes time to get the hang of, but is logical once you learn your way around. Most selections are made using the center console, since there are not many buttons on the steering wheel. I'm enjoying the panoramic roof more than I expected since it fills the interior with light and makes the car feel even roomier. I have the 20 inch wheels and I'm pleased that this does not make the ride harsh. This SUV has a firm ride and handles more like a sedan. Even on a 6 hour drive I did not feel fatigued and felt confident driving in a torrential rainstorm. Looking forward to seeing how it handles the snow, once I put the 17 inch blizzaks on. So far, very satisfied with my purchase.

I named mine Danica
Audi Owner, Houston, TX, 12/04/2022
2016 Audi Q5 TDI Premium Plus quattro 4dr SUV AWD (3.0L 6cyl Turbodiesel 8A)
My wife and I nicknamed out 2016 Q5 “Danica”, because like its namesake, Danica Patrick, it is tough as nails and fast as hell, but it always looks beautiful and classy.
Many things about our Q5 TDI are surprising - mostly good and a few not so good. It has great acceleration and sports sedan-like handling, unbelievable efficiency for its size, and top-of-the line build quality.
It … also has surprising poor technology for the model year, and unusable voice recognition. The over sized outside mirrors give a panoramic view rearward, but create a very large blind spot that can be disconcerting, to say the least.
Overall I’d say it was the best vehicle in its class in 2016, the last model year that the Diesel engine was offered. The 3.0 liter diesel is perfectly suited to this car, and it’s a pity that engine had to be scrapped in subsequent years.
UPDATE: I own a 2016 Q5 TDI after my first 2014 model was totaled in a flood. I was pleased and delighted to find a replacement.
Where do I begin? The turbo diesel is simply the best possible engine for this SUV, by far. It is extremely quick, and combined with the sports car like suspension it’s a bona fide sporting rival to the 2017 Audi S3 that I also own - but with much more room and utility.
The one drawback - as others have mentioned - is the surprising lack of technology in a car of this generation, at this price point. I literally have to plug a phone charger into the cigarette lighter to charge a phone. That’s ridiculous.
But that omission pales in comparison to the car’s merits: high quality interior, top notch construction, remarkable fuel efficiency, and sports sedan-like handling. This vehicle has it all.
My Audi dealer sends repeated offers to buy this car back from me in exchange for a newer model, but since the diesel is irreplaceable, and it’s the best engine ever offered in the Q5, I will never trade it for a newer Q5.
Great motor, outdated distracting controls
David, Carson City, NV, 11/22/2019
2016 Audi Q5 TDI Premium Plus quattro 4dr SUV AWD (3.0L 6cyl Turbodiesel 8A)
If you've had a car with modern features like usable touch-screen, lane-keep, adaptive cruise, voice control that understands English... you'll hate a lot about this car like I do. If you don't mind obsolete technology like thumb-wheels and scroll-wheels that incite rage and distracting button locations, it's otherwise a pretty nice ride. The tdi is a great motor that provides quiet … sports-car-like acceleration while still getting really good fuel economy. Where I live in the Lake Tahoe region, the torque is really appreciated. The tdi's power climbs the long steep grades like no other vehicle I've driven (including my PowerStroke). For me, the size is a plus - more sports sedan than mommy-wagon, yet comfortable for adults in the back seat and enough cargo space for most of my needs, although I'm glad to have the F250 as backup.
Edmunds Summary Review of the 2016 Audi Q5 TDI Premium Plus quattro Diesel
Pros & Cons
- Pro:Top-notch interior craftsmanship
- Pro:rapid acceleration from 3.0T engine
- Pro:unique sliding rear seat provides extra versatility
- Pro:refined driving character makes it feel expensive from the behind the wheel
- Pro:understated styling that doesn't draw too much attention to itself
- Pro:more standard features (including all-wheel drive) than its German-brand competitors.
- Con:Ride may be too firm for some
- Con:electronic controls aren't as advanced as those in rivals or even some newer Audis
- Con:frustrating lack of a USB port
- Con:no accident-avoidance technology is available
- Con:diesel model has been discontinued due to faulty emissions equipment.
